Trust. Fight. Unity. The Rise of Slovakia’s Lionesses

In August 2024, I was approached by the Slovak Futsal Association to join the women’s national team coaching staff as a mental coach in preparation for the FIFA Women’s Futsal World Cup 2026 qualification tournament in Sweden. The timeline was extremely tight, with only six days of preparation before the tournament began.

Stillness Before the Storm: Rewiring Kyrgyzstan’s Mindset”

Right before the start of the Asian Cup 2023 in Qatar, we had a unique opportunity – to work with the Kyrgyz men’s national football team during the final stage of their preparation.
The mental side of the game, players’ mindset under pressure, and overall team dynamics play a crucial role at this level – especially for a nation that has never experienced this kind of mental coaching before.

When Goals Aren’t Enough: How a Young Hockey Player Escaped Pressure and Found His Path

John Doe (athlete’s anonymity) was a young hockey player who struggled to transfer his performance from training to games. He worked hard on himself, but during matches, nervousness and uncertainty led to inconsistent performance. Sometimes he was way down, other times way up. But these were just glimpses of the form he envisioned for himself as a result of his training efforts.
